In this Jazz Guitar Today lesson, Davy Mooney once again explores pentatonic applications.
In this video, Mooney tackles another piece from Pat Metheny’s Bright Size Life, “Missouri Uncompromised,” and once again explores pentatonic applications, as well as the challenges of improvising over harmony that is more folk and rock music-based.
